Did you know?
Recent research indicates that children who miss 30% or more of school are significantly more likely to experience mental health issues, including stress and anxiety.
๐ Specifically, the probability of a child experiencing mental ill health rises from 1.82% with no absence to 3.7% with 20% absence, and to 5.27% with 30% absence.
This trend is particularly concerning for children with special educational needs and disabilities (SEND), chronic health conditions, or an Education, Health and Care (EHC) plan.

๐ค Better Sleep Tips for Children
Good sleep is vital for wellbeing. Try these 3 tips:
โจ No devices 2 hours before bed
โจ Night light or favourite toy for comfort
โจ End the day with 3 good things

๐ Did You Know?
Big emotions are a normal part of growing up. Helping children name and understand their feelings builds resilience, while calming activities like breathing, drawing or mindful play can ease stress.
โจ Parent Tip:
Name their feelings, create a calm-down toolkit, and show them healthy ways to cope by modelling your own. Small steps make a big difference. ๐

Iโve always had a thirst for nurturing the soul and those of others. I would give anything a go if it meant I could develop myself in some way or another. That was very much the thread of my childhood. Self-discovery was very much the reason for taking a break from education. Travelling the world was on my agenda. Such beautiful diversity.
Upon my return I studied a degree in education with a focus in pastoral care, philosophy and meta-cognition. Bringing this into my teaching was invaluable to the young minds that I had the pleasure in teaching.
But it wasnโt until 11 years into my career that things took a change in my whole world. A dear friend took her own life. Unbeknown to anyone, she suffered in silence with her mental health. This rocked the very depths of my world. I struggled to detach from this in order to get on with life and I became critically aware of my role as a mother, as a wife and as a teacher. If this tragic event can happen to someone who was deemed so very strong, happy and content then, who else is masking how they are truly feeling? Who else is trying to cope with their daily lives?
I also felt a burning guilt; as a teacher, was I adding to the childrenโs stress, their need to be validated and a pressure to succeed? Was I fundamentally supporting their emotional and mental wellbeing?
Upon a lengthy reflection, I very much felt the answer was a big, juicy no. This was largely due to unrealistic educational expectations and targets for most, and, institutionalised behavioural conditioning which, was all down to the very structure and fabric of our education system. I had realised that I had gotten somewhat lost and was in a system that I very much did not agree with.
The next significant moment was a moment of synchronicity. I met a Tai Chi master who came to teach my class. We all embraced this lovely, new experience. It was then I realised the possibilities of Tai Chi and how it could tick all my boxes in relation to supporting childrenโs social, emotional, mental and personal wellbeing.
I am now a qualified Youth Mental Health First-Aider, Chi for Children, Qigong and Mindfulness instructor. I no longer teach as a class teacher but am on a journey of empowering young children to think and feel great, reaching out to families to support their social. emotional, mental, personal and physical wellbeing.
